This study mapped the persistence of stereotypical attitudes and perceptions to gender by collecting real-life stories from women and men across the EU. These stories help to identify the ways in which gender stereotypical perceptions influence people’s lives. The researchers identified belief systems, patterns and norms of behaviour that reinforce gender stereotypes, including general observations on regional differences and evolution over time. The study focused specifically on the “triggers of change” in people’s attitudes to gender and identified the key factors contributing to breaking stereotypical gender patterns.
Synthesis report The ‘Study of collected narratives on gender perceptions in the 27 EU Member States’ has been commissioned by EIGE with the aim of mapping the persistence of stereotypical gender attitudes and perceptions.
